I don't think that you can - it was a promotional thing from waaaaaay back. You had to login to the website for the game and follow the instructions there (which I have utterly forgotten. I think a short film was involved?).

Either that or you had to have bought the limited collectors edition (I think).

To be fair, it's not that amazing - you get a chicken suit and some Halo stuff, but it's not long before you want to upgrade to better items. The money is nice, but easy to earn/steal/find throughout the game as it is.
